Discover the intriguing world beneath the surface on the Classic Cave Tour at Colossal Cave Mountain Park. This family-friendly tour spans half a mile and takes about 40 minutes, showcasing stunning stalactites, stalagmites, and other unique geological formations. Delve into the cave's rich history filled with legends of train robbers and ghosts while observing the local wildlife. Perfect for families, this tour requires no special gear—just come in comfortable shoes and be ready for an adventure in this captivating underground environment. - Guided tour lasting approximately 55 minutes - Explore fascinating geological formations and learn local legends - Suitable for families; recommended for ages 5 and up - Tours available daily on the hour, year-round, but space is limited.

Discover the natural beauty of Lower Antelope Canyon, a slot canyon located in northern Arizona in Lake Powell Navajo Tribal Park. Lower Antelope Canyon is shallower than Upper Antelope Canyon, both of which are part of the Navajo Nation and require a guided tour; advanced reservations are highly recommended to check out this popular spot in Page.

Antelope Canyon is on private land within the Navajo Nation and can only be visited on guided tours. This experience grants admission and provides a Navajo-guided walking tour of Canyon X, a lesser-known section of Antelope Canyon known for its ‘X’ shape created by flood erosion and strong winds.
